Newhof and Rykse's big nights lead Cougars to victory over (RV) IWU

 
SPRING ARBOR, MI. – The Spring Arbor men's basketball team came into Wednesday night's contest with an Indiana Wesleyan team that is receiving votes, looking to break out of a funk that had seen them drop 5 of their last 6 games. 
 
The first half began with both teams getting buckets quick, and Indiana Wesleyan had the early advantage, holding a 16-11 lead at the first media timeout. The Wildcats would keep that 5 point advantage, 21-16 at the second media break, as both teams traded 5 points apiece. From there, Spring Arbor went on a quick 7-0 run to claim the lead, courtesy of five points from Travis Grayson, and a bucket from Gabe Newhof. The two squads would trade the lead back and forth a few times before Spring Arbor claimed it for the rest of the half at the 5:29 mark, eventually taking a 43-40 advantage into the locker room. Gabe Newhof and Shane Ryske were catalysts offensively for the Cougars in the half, with Newhof leading all scorers in the period with 14, and Ryske adding 11 points, including three from behind the arc. 
 
The second half started out quiet, with nearly two minutes passing by before the first bucket; a Dante Favor three-ball; was scored. Favor's bucket started a 13-5 run for the Cougars to open the second stanza, extending Spring Arbor's halftime lead to 11, 56-45, at the 15-minute media timeout. IWU would trim their deficit to 6, 66-60 at the 10-minute media stoppage, but Spring Arbor would hold serve for the rest of the contest, not letting the Wildcats get within 5 and making some big shots down the stretch to claim a huge victory, 84-75. Newhof, Rykse, and Travis Grayson all produced big buckets in the period, with Newhof dropping 13 points, and Ryske and Grayson both adding 10 points. 
 
SCORE: Spring Arbor 84, Indiana Wesleyan 75
LOCATION: Spring Arbor, MI | American 1 Credit Union Arena
RECORDS: Spring Arbor 15-8, 7-6 | Indiana Wesleyan 15-8, 5-8
 
 
GAME HIGHLIGHTS
  • Gabe Newhof had a huge game to lead the Cougars to victory, leading all scorers with 27 points, going 10-10 from the free throw line, and adding 6 rebounds, 4 steals and a block. Newhof also made his first career 3-pointer in the contest. 
  • Along with Newhof's big performance, freshman Shane Rykse and junior Travis Grayson also provided huge contributions. Rykse poured in 21 points on an efficient 7 of 9 shooting, including 5 of 7 from deep. He also added 2 rebounds and an assist. Grayson scored 19 points, joining Newhof by also going a perfect 10-10 from the charity stripe. He also recorded 4 assists, a steal and a rebound. 
  • Dante Favor and Kevyn Robertson also filled up the stat sheet in different ways. Favor chipped in 8 points, secured 6 rebounds, and dished out 2 assists, along with a block. Robertson had 8 rebounds, 7 assists, and 6 points.  
  • The win marks the first victory for Spring Arbor over Indiana Wesleyan since 2018, breaking an 11-game losing streak against the Wildcats. 
  • Indiana Wesleyan was led in scoring by Luke Brown and Griffin Kliewer, with Brown scoring 22 points, on 7 of 14 shooting, including 5 of 9 from 3, and Kliewer adding 21 points on 8 of 16 shooting, and 3 of 6 from deep. 
 
TEAM STATS:
FG Percentage: Indiana Wesleyan 47.2%, Spring Arbor 47.1%
3PT Percentage: Indiana Wesleyan 52.4%, Spring Arbor 47.6%
FT Percentage: Indiana Wesleyan 63.6%, Spring Arbor 92.9%
Rebounds: Indiana Wesleyan 29, Spring Arbor 33
Assists: Indiana Wesleyan 13, Spring Arbor 17
Turnovers: Indiana Wesleyan 11, Spring Arbor 7
Points off Turnovers: Indiana Wesleyan 5, Spring Arbor 16
2nd Chance Points: Indiana Wesleyan 7, Spring Arbor 10
Bench Points: Indiana Wesleyan 14, Spring Arbor 3
Points in Paint: Indiana Wesleyan 26, Spring Arbor 24
